[lldb_test_suite] Fix lldb test suite targeting remote Android
Summary: Fixed `Android.rules` for running test suite on remote android - the build configuration is not compatible with ndk structure, change it to link to static libc++ - generally clang should be able to use libc++ and will link against the right library, but some libc++ installations require the user manually link libc++abi. - add flag `-lc++abi` to fix the test binary build failure
Added `skipIfTargetAndroid` `skipUnlessTargetAndroid` for better test support - the `skipIfPlatform` method will ask `lldbplatformutil.getPlatform()` for platform info which is actually the os type, and //Android// is not os type but environment - create this function to handle the android target condition
**To Run Test on Remote Android** 1 start lldb-server on your devices 2 run lldb-dotest with following configuration: `./lldb-dotest --out-of-tree-debugserver --arch aarch64 --platform-name remote-android --platform-url connect://localhost:12345 --platform-working-dir /data/local/tmp/ --compiler your/ndk/clang`

Android.rules: Use libc++ by default
libstdc++ will soon be dropped from the android NDK. This patch makes sure we are prepared for that by using libc++ in tests by default (i.e., except for libstdc++ data formatter tests).
Only a couple of small tweaks were needed to make this work: - Add the libc++ include paths to CXXFLAGS only. This was necessary to make the tests compile with -fmodules. The modules tests have been disabled, but this way, they will be ready for them if they are enabled. - in one test I had to add an explicit std::string copy to make sure the copy constructor is there for the expression evaluator to find it.

Centralize libc++ test skipping logic
Summary: This aims to replace the different decorators we've had on each libc++ test with a single solution. Each libc++ will be assigned to the "libc++" category and a single central piece of code will decide whether we are actually able to run libc++ test in the given configuration by enabling or disabling the category (while giving the user the opportunity to override this).
I started this effort because I wanted to get libc++ tests running on android, and none of the existing decorators worked for this use case: - skipIfGcc - incorrect, we can build libc++ executables on android with gcc (in fact, after this, we can now do it on linux as well) - lldbutil.skip_if_library_missing - this checks whether libc++.so is loaded in the proces, which fails in case of a statically linked libc++ (this makes copying executables to the remote target easier to manage).
To make this work I needed to split out the pseudo_barrier code from the force-included file, as libc++'s atomic does not play well with gcc on linux, and this made every test fail, even though we need the code only in the threading tests.
So far, I am only annotating one of the tests with this category. If this does not break anything, I'll proceed to update the rest.

testsuite/android: build test executables with the android ndk directly
Summary: This teaches the test makefiles about the Android NDK, so we are able to run the tests without first going through the make_standalone_toolchain script. The motivation for this is the ability to run both libc++ and libstdc++ tests together, which previously was not possible because make_standalone_toolchain bakes in the STL to use during toolchain creation time. The support for this is not present yet -- this change only make sure we don't regress for existing funcionality (gcc w/ libstdc++). Clang and libc++ support will be added later.
I've checked that the mips android targets compile after this change, but I have no way of checking whether this breaks anything. If you are reading this and it broke you, let me know.
